paraplegia
noun/ˌpærəˈpliːdʒə/
/ˌpærəˈpliːdʒə/
[uncountable]- paralysis (= loss of control or feeling) in the legs and lower bodyTopics Disabilityc2Word Originmid 17th cent.: modern Latin, from Greek paraplēgia, from paraplēssein ‘strike at the side’, from para ‘beside’ + plēssein ‘to strike’.
